如何快速提升英语打字效率?Qwerty Learner 完整使用指南 🚀
【免费下载链接】qwerty-learner 项目地址: https://gitcode.com/gh_mirrors/qw/qwerty-learner
Qwerty Learner 是一款专为键盘工作者设计的单词记忆与英语肌肉记忆锻炼软件。它借鉴了著名打字网站 Keybr 的设计理念,通过算法自动生成训练材料,帮助用户集中锻炼输入较慢的字母,同时结合单词记忆,提高英文打字效率。软件提供了多种考试级别的词库、音标显示、发音功能及默写模式,适合不同层次的学习者。
📚 项目核心功能介绍
单词记忆与打字训练结合
Qwerty Learner 最独特的地方在于将单词记忆与打字练习完美融合。传统的打字软件只注重按键速度,而这款工具会在你练习打字的同时,潜移默化地帮你记住单词拼写和含义。
智能算法生成训练内容
系统会分析你的打字习惯,自动识别你输入较慢的字母和单词,然后有针对性地生成训练材料。这样的个性化训练能让你在最短时间内提升薄弱环节。
丰富的词库资源
项目提供了多种考试级别的词库,涵盖了从小学到GRE等各个阶段的英语词汇。你可以在 public/dicts/ 目录下找到所有可用的词库文件,如 CET4_T.json、GRE3000_3_T.json 等。
多模式练习
软件支持多种练习模式,包括:
- 标准打字模式:直接进行单词输入练习
- 默写模式:强化记忆效果
- 听力模式:通过发音来输入单词
🚀 快速启动指南
环境准备
克隆仓库
打开终端或命令行,执行以下命令克隆项目:
git clone https://gitcode.com/gh_mirrors/qw/qwerty-learner
cd qwerty-learner
安装依赖并启动
在项目根目录下运行以下命令:
yarn install
yarn start
项目将在 http://localhost:5173/ 地址自动启动,你可以打开浏览器访问。
💻 软件界面展示
Qwerty Learner 软件主界面,展示了打字练习区域和学习数据统计
🌟 应用案例和最佳实践
英语学习者
每天花15-20分钟进行单词和拼写练习,可以有效提升英语输入速度和单词记忆效果。建议初学者从基础词库开始,如 public/dicts/Oxford3000.json。
程序员
利用内置的IT相关词库,如 public/dicts/it-words.json 和 public/dicts/python-builtin.json,可针对性地提高工作中常用词汇和术语的输入效率。
备考者
如需参加英语水平考试(如 TOEFL、GRE),使用对应的定制词库进行专门训练。例如 GRE 考生可以选择 public/dicts/GRE3000_3_T.json。
最佳学习策略
- 定期进行默写模式的练习,强化记忆
- 关注速度和正确率的动态变化,调整练习策略
- 每天坚持练习,形成肌肉记忆
- 利用软件的统计功能,跟踪学习进度
🛠️ 技术架构
Qwerty Learner 采用现代化的前端技术栈构建:
核心框架
- React:用于构建用户界面
- Vite:作为前端构建工具,提供快速的开发体验
UI组件与样式
- Tailwind CSS:用于样式设计,提供实用且易用的 UI 样式
- 自定义组件:位于 src/components/ 目录
状态管理
- Jotai:用于状态管理,相关代码在 src/store/ 目录
数据处理
📝 使用技巧
自定义词库
如果你有特定的单词列表需要学习,可以创建自己的 JSON 词库文件,按照现有词库的格式添加单词,然后放入 public/dicts/ 目录下。
调整练习设置
在软件设置中,你可以调整以下参数来优化学习体验:
- 练习时长
- 单词难度
- 是否显示音标
- 是否开启发音功能
快捷键使用
掌握这些快捷键可以提高你的练习效率:
- 空格键:确认输入
- Tab键:切换词库
- Esc键:暂停练习
📚 官方文档与资源
- 项目文档:docs/
- 贡献指南:docs/CONTRIBUTING.md
- 词库构建指南:docs/toBuildDict.md
Qwerty Learner 是一款功能强大且易用的英语打字学习软件,通过科学的方法帮助你同时提升打字速度和单词记忆能力。无论你是英语学习者、程序员还是备考学生,都能从中获益。现在就开始你的高效学习之旅吧!
【免费下载链接】qwerty-learner 项目地址: https://gitcode.com/gh_mirrors/qw/qwerty-learner
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



